Compared to yellow light, orange light has

<span>So we want to know what does orange light has when we compare it to yellow light. So when we take a look at the electromagnetic spectrum we can see that orange color has longer wavelength than yellow color. So the correct answer is A. alonger wavelength.</span>

What is meant by the term law of conservation?​
GalinKa [24]

Answer:

Explanation:

any law stating that some quantity or property remains constant during and after an interaction or process, as conservation of charge or conservation of linear momentum.
